As the end of 2008 approaches looms, there are several Arizona Tax Credit programs hat let you take a dollar-for-dollar credit. Not a deduction - a CREDIT! Example: If you owe $400.00 to the state, and you have contributed $400.00 to one of these programs, you would owe nothing. And you would get money refunded, if you've paid too much through payroll deductions! Here are my favorite three:
Arizona Public School Tax Credit - $200 for an individual, or $400 for a married couple, filing jointly. This must be donated to a public school extra-curricular program. Many sports teams, etc., depend on these contributions.
Arizona Private School Tuition Tax Credit - $500 for an individual, or $1,000 for a married couple filing jointly. If you know any private school attendees(not your own children, but you could 'buddy-up' with another family), you may be able to reduce tuition expenses while significantly reducing your tax obligation.
Arizona Military Family Relief Fund - $200 for an individual, or $400 for a married couple filing jointly. This fund supports the families of military personnel who have been injured or killed in combat.
